Transaction c63b2c77387a006e01eea8dfb88f8c78a7475a44bf6e1fad3e1d080a7e3ab222

6 Input
2 Outputs
  • c63b2c77387a006e01eea8dfb88f8c78a7475a44bf6e1fad3e1d080a7e3ab222:0
  • value  994550
    address  376h6CrLFDkTgKtRBfcNVQ2sgUPZ4hACDZ
  • c63b2c77387a006e01eea8dfb88f8c78a7475a44bf6e1fad3e1d080a7e3ab222:1
  • value  25172837
    address  34e6X2YYTkGhhhkYSx3rLuVhTEyo4hCSKi